Juan RP
1c5f4690e6
xbps-src: always require current srcpkgs version in build dependencies.
...
That means that version comparators are not supported anymore in
hostmakedepends and makedepends.
This will ensure that a pkg is always built with the same build dependencies
everywhere, if the srcpkgs tree is uptodate.
2015-03-27 10:59:58 +01:00
Juan RP
e4fd43af35
{b,d}ash: rebuild with full relro.
2015-03-18 09:50:33 +01:00
lemmi
e37edceabb
bash: add -DSYS_BASHRC to CFLAGS
...
this enables bash to source a system-wide bashrc.
currently set to /etc/bash/bashrc.
2015-03-05 15:23:02 +01:00
Juan RP
ec6cd0b379
bash: switch private vars order.
2015-03-04 19:54:36 +01:00
Juan RP
b5c3c43509
srcpkgs: set build_pie to almost all possible pkgs in base.
2015-03-04 19:44:01 +01:00
Juan RP
4a50d00f69
bash: update to 4.3 patchlevel 033.
2014-12-31 08:28:33 +01:00
Juan RP
29a398d4ad
bash: remove useless docs.
2014-10-10 08:33:01 +02:00
Juan RP
d438c91e4e
bash: update to 4.3 patchlevel 030.
2014-10-06 08:34:04 +02:00
Juan RP
197b4d0341
bash: update to 4.3 patchlevel 029.
2014-10-03 04:59:52 +02:00
Juan RP
b949395d9b
bash: update to 4.3 patchlevel 028.
2014-10-01 22:29:00 +02:00
Juan RP
3098184499
bash: apply 3rd patch for CVE-2014-7169 from Fedora too.
2014-09-28 12:07:34 +02:00
Juan RP
53418864fb
bash: drop NetBSD patches now that CVE-2014-7186 has a patch.
2014-09-28 11:59:00 +02:00
Juan RP
874491640b
bash: update to 4.3 patchlevel 027 (CVE-2014-7186).
2014-09-28 11:56:49 +02:00
Juan RP
1c22f1e6f3
bash: apply NetBSD patches to disable importing functions from environment.
...
This avoids completely shellshock.
1)
$NetBSD: patch-shell.c,v 1.1 2014/09/25 20:28:32 christos Exp $
Add flag to disable importing of function unless explicitly enabled
2)
$NetBSD: patch-variables.c,v 1.1 2014/09/25 20:28:32 christos Exp $
Only read functions from environment if flag is set.
2014-09-27 06:36:58 +02:00
Juan RP
c2063e026e
bash: update to 4.3 patchlevel 026 (fixes CVE-2014-7169).
2014-09-27 03:19:21 +02:00
Juan RP
2dd9420b25
bash: update to patchlevel 025 and apply 2nd patch for CVE-2014-6271.
...
See http://seclists.org/oss-sec/2014/q3/690
2014-09-25 20:29:21 +02:00
Juan RP
554baa4d3e
bash: patch for CVE-2014-6271 via Novell.
2014-09-24 16:26:29 +02:00
Juan RP
659ca5bbac
bash: update to 4.3 patchlevel 024.
2014-08-19 06:39:14 +02:00
Juan RP
1b4cfe542e
bash: update to 4.3 patchlevel 022.
2014-08-11 07:27:44 +02:00
Jan S
3786db114f
bash: update to 4.3.018
2014-05-26 23:12:27 +02:00
Jan S
9ca5abdb1f
bash: update to 4.3 patch level 011.
2014-04-15 08:39:38 +02:00
Juan RP
f8e45c8de0
bash: update to 4.3 patch level 008.
2014-04-04 12:12:20 +02:00
Juan RP
4d4bb70765
bash: rebuild with system readline.
2014-03-15 09:02:52 +01:00
Juan RP
2835ff1baa
bash: rebuild to drop compressed manpages.
2014-03-14 09:11:21 +01:00
Juan RP
4329784c14
bash: update to 4.3.
2014-02-27 07:14:13 +01:00
Juan RP
925d471cbf
Update all source packages for xbps-src>=90.
2014-01-01 16:10:11 +01:00
Juan RP
9c87483ea8
Convert packages the new template format (a-c range).
2013-04-12 08:55:23 +02:00
Juan RP
ea38e4719a
Convert packages to {host,}makedepends and XBPS_CROSS_BUILD.
2013-03-24 10:21:58 +01:00
Juan RP
9e23a5e17c
bash: override some tests for proper cross builds.
2013-03-19 03:27:37 +01:00
Juan RP
2214694438
Revbump pkgs affected by the xbps-create/fakeroot bug.
2013-03-15 10:06:30 +01:00
Juan RP
9c74a8f168
bash: update to 4.2 patch level 045.
2013-03-13 09:35:38 +01:00
Juan RP
e409d2ea2d
bash: cross build support.
2013-02-07 00:41:13 +01:00
Juan RP
9a8aba3e7a
bash: conflicts with chroot-bash.
2013-02-01 11:06:46 +01:00
Juan RP
347d970dc5
bash: remove ncurses-devel; readline-devel already includes it.
2013-01-27 08:19:46 +01:00
Juan RP
8b1371c16f
bash: update to 4.2 patchlevel 042.
2013-01-03 14:54:15 +01:00
Juan RP
fc414fbf96
bash: update to 4.2 patch level 039.
2012-12-01 09:04:18 +01:00
Juan RP
126f27f8c3
Remove the rshlibs; they do more harm than good.
2012-11-21 04:19:43 +01:00
Juan RP
040273bfc1
bash: update to 4.2 patch level 037.
2012-07-20 07:36:35 +02:00
Juan RP
c16238ebe6
bash: update to 4.2 patch level 036.
2012-07-11 02:56:10 +02:00
Juan RP
c266c1d192
bash: switch to /usr.
2012-07-09 17:12:59 +02:00
Juan RP
6d241d2375
Set revision=1 to all pkgs. It's required now to set it.
2012-06-03 09:08:53 +02:00
Juan RP
b6ee47e78e
bash: update to 4.2 patch level 029.
2012-06-02 08:54:22 +02:00
Juan RP
1816de0e4a
Update all packages for xbps-src>=28. WARNING: xbps-src-28 (or from git) required!
2012-05-23 18:26:56 +02:00
Juan RP
8682590294
bash: update to 4.2 patch level 028.
2012-05-05 03:12:44 +02:00
Juan RP
4f377956e5
bash: update to 4.2 patch level 024.
2012-03-13 07:22:39 +01:00
Juan RP
a4175094d2
bash: built with external readline, revbump.
2012-03-09 00:03:09 +01:00
Juan RP
100c266fe2
Remove builddeps provided in base-chroot>=0.27.
2012-02-28 18:41:56 +01:00
Juan RP
443d765eae
bash: not a bootstrap pkg anymore.
2012-02-28 10:21:44 +01:00
Juan RP
ad2194ebf2
Remove flist files; not the way to go. I'll find another way.
2012-02-10 16:59:21 +01:00
Juan RP
50c2ff1926
First pass at creating flist files, will be used by the upcoming xbps-src-18.
2012-02-10 09:25:25 +01:00